When parallel flow lines converge and diverge, again the relationships defined by Darcys law can be used to hypothesize possible subsurface conditions. The primary driving force of fresh submarine groundwater discharge is the hydraulic gradient from the upland region of a watershed to the surface water discharge location at the coast. To maintain a state of dynamic equilibrium, groundwater withdrawal by pumping must be balanced by (1) an increase in recharge, (2) a decrease in natural discharge, (3) a loss of storage, (4) or a combination of these factors. high porosity Groundwater is a crucial source of fresh water throughout the world. Although a lot of water can be present in the unsaturated zone, this water cannot be pumped by wells because it is held too tightly by capillary forces. The age of ground water increases steadily along a particular flow path through the ground-water-flow system from an area of recharge to an area of discharge. To generate a potentiometric map of a groundwater system, care must be taken to assure that piezometers and wells used to collect data represent horizontal flow conditions (or near-horizontal conditions). Rapid-infiltration pits: One way is to spread water over the land in pits, furrows, or ditches, or to erect small dams in stream channels to detain and deflect surface runoff, thereby allowing it to infiltrate to the aquifer. If cross sections are constructed at some angle other than parallel to groundwater flow, they will not represent vertical flow conditions along the flow path even though a vertical distribution of head can be plotted on the section (e.g., the W-NE section of Figure 80c and d).
